Most of you would have seen a camera shutter tucked inside the camera body and hiding behind the lens, and if your camera is a D-SLR, behind the mirror. The shutter plays an extremely important role in controlling the duration for which the sensor is exposed to light. Hence, along with the diaphragm in the lens, it is a critical component to regulate the light falling on the sensor and hence, to determine the exposure. Still camera shutters come in three main types, viz.

• Leaf shutters

• Focal Plane shutters

• Electronic shutters
